Please describe your company's culture both in the office and after hours. Let us know about the structure and hierarchy, cooperation and teamwork, and socialising amongst colleagues.
During office hours, the workplace demands are reasonable and boundaries for work life balance are respected and enforced by colleagues throughout the organisation. Among graduates, the culture is quite social and friendly. Within teams, there is not a large culture of after-work socialising.

very structured and hierarchal. lots of corporation and team work within teams. lots of social events outside of work - both self organised and Bank organised.

The culture is good and there has been an increase in focus of being more open and dynamic. Everyone is quite friendly and willing to have a chat in the office. Management are approachable and willing to help. I feel like there could be more socialising after office hours within Finance, but I do get that interaction with the other graduates across different departments.
